🩺 WHAT IS A DOCTOR HOME VISIT?

A doctor home visit is a personalized medical consultation provided by a qualified physician at the patient’s residence. This service is especially helpful for bedridden patients, elderly people, disabled individuals, or those too weak to travel.

Doctors examine, diagnose, prescribe treatment, and provide referrals — all within the home setting.

✨ SERVICES INCLUDED

  • General physical check-up.
  • Monitoring of vitals: BP, pulse, sugar, oxygen levels.
  • Diagnosis of fever, infection, cough, cold, breathing issues.
  • Follow-up after surgery or hospital discharge.
  • Prescription of medications or lab tests.
  • Referral to specialists or hospital (if needed).
  • Coordination with home nurses or physiotherapists.

🌿 NATURE OF SERVICE

  • On-call or scheduled home visits.
  • Typically available between 9 AM – 8 PM, some offer 24×7 emergency.
  • Visit duration: around 20–40 minutes depending on the case.
  • Can be one-time or part of a monthly elder care plan.
